Error when trying to start mailbox services
Error when trying to start mailbox services
Problem
Error when trying to start mailbox services:
Exception in thread "main" java.io.IOException: Keystore was tampered with, or password was incorrect at sun.security.provider.JavaKeyStore.engineLoad(JavaKeyStore.java:771) at sun.security.provider.JavaKeyStore$JKS.engineLoad(JavaKeyStore.java:38) at java.security.KeyStore.load(KeyStore.java:1185)
Solution
This problem comes up because the Java keystore is either changed, or not accessible. Regenerating the certificates creates a new keystore.
To do so, first move the old keystore:
mv /opt/zimbra/mailboxd/etc/keystore /root/keystore.old
Then re-generate certificates and restart the mailbox service:
/opt/zimbra/bin/zmcertmgr createca -new /opt/zimbra/bin/zmcertmgr createcrt -new -days 3650 /opt/zimbra/bin/zmcertmgr deployca /opt/zimbra/bin/zmcertmgr deploycrt self /opt/zimbra/bin/zmcertmgr viewdeployedcrt zmmailboxdctl restart
Submitted by: Sourabh Bhushan